Hotel Orrington address: 1710 Orrington Avenue, Evanston, 60201
Hotel Orrington details: Welcome to the newly reopened Hotel Orrington, formerly the Omni Orrington, the only AAA four diamond hotel located in Evanston, Illinois. After completing a 34 million dollar renovation, Hotel Orrington brings a refreshing alternative to the typical North Shore hotel, joining contemporary style and historic elegance, with impeccable guest service. With its classic modern look and excellent location, Hotel Orrington provides a unique oasis of urban sophistication for the modern traveler.
In addition, downtown Chicago is only 30 minutes away.
-Hotel valet parking charge is USD 20 per day.
-Complimentary Wireless Internet in the public areas. Hardwired/data port access in guest rooms also complimentary.
-Up to 2 pets allowed in the guest room (dogs must be under 50 pounds) with a charge of USD 50 per stay per pet.
-Hotel and rooms are wheel chair accessible, including rooms with adequate bathroom and bed (4 people per room).

Location
When you arrive at the Hotel Orrington, you will be pleasantly surprised by the natural beauty and charm of Evanston, IL. Located just north of Chicago, Evanston, Illinois has a stunning natural setting on Lake Michigan with unique business districts, attractive homes on tree-lined streets, and pleasant public parks. In addition to the spectacular natural setting, Evanston, Illinois has something for everyone. Choose from a wide range of dining options, art galleries, unique shops, cafés, bookstores and entertainment venues. And of course, it's all right outside your door at the Hotel Orrington.
Facilities
Dining
Globe Café & Bar:Geared to today’s business professional and educated travelers who want to keep up with world events. This friendly neighborhood restaurant offers newspapers and magazines, flat screen TVs and “media towers” located throughout the café, along with high-speed wireless Internet. Plus, really great food with private dining areas accommodating up to 20.
Indigo Lounge:
Indigo is the perfect spot to get the night started or hang out for the evening. You'll find wine, beer, cocktails and live sounds. It's the place on the North Shore to gather with friends and colleagues. It's also ideal for a casual business meeting.
